Banpresto is a Japanese company founded in 1977. It specializes in the manufacture and distribution of gaming and collectible merchandise, including licensed anime figures from franchises such as Dragon Ball and Jujutsu Kaisen. In 2006, Banpresto was acquired by Bandai Namco Entertainment.
